> Scan Dual: 2400 DPI and SCSI-2 (only)
> Scan Dual 2: 2820 DPI and USB (only)
>
> One feature I like about the Scan Dual 2: It's slide/negative adaptor is
> fully motorized and automated. This means it can scan all 4/6 slides/negs
> automagically (it takes about 0.5-1.0 hrs, if you scan at 2820 DPI and 36
> bits, like I do).
>
> features they both do *NOT* have: ICE, bulk slide adaptor
